When drawing the structure of a neutral organic compound, you will find it helpful to remember that. each carbon atom has four bonds. each nitrogen atom has three bonds. each oxygen atom has two bonds. … WebDec 14, 2024 · Step 4: Number your carbon atoms. First, notice any side groups, or any molecule or atom that hangs from your longest (or parent) chain. Okay, now locate the two ends of your carbon chain.
